I. INTRODUCTION

Appellant Kristina Ramos pled guilty pursuant to a plea agreement to the Class B misdemeanor offense of driving while intoxicated (DWI). Prior to her plea, appellant filed a motion to suppress all blood evidence obtained following her accident and all results of any testing of such evidence.
